The Heart of the Dragon
The moon hung low in the sky, casting an ethereal glow over the ancient forest of Elaria. In the heart of this enchanted wood, a young cultivator named Liana moved silently through the shadows, her heart heavy with the burden of a secret that could shake the very foundations of her world.
Liana was a human, a rare cultivator born with the ability to harness the essence of the earth, a power that was forbidden to her kind. Yet, she had found solace in the company of the dragons, who were as rare as they were revered. Among them, she had fallen for Ahrim, a majestic dragon with scales that shimmered like the night sky itself.
Ahrim had been her mentor, his wisdom and strength guiding her through the treacherous paths of cultivation. But their love was a flame that could never be openly acknowledged, for it was forbidden by the elders of their respective clans. They had to keep their bond hidden, a dangerous secret that could cost them their lives.
As Liana navigated the labyrinthine paths of the forest, she felt the weight of her choice pressing down on her. She knew that if she were to continue cultivating with Ahrim by her side, she would be forever shunned by her own people. Yet, the thought of losing Ahrim was a pain she could not bear.
Suddenly, a rustling in the bushes behind her startled her. She turned to see a figure stepping out of the shadows, the eyes of the dragon Ahrim narrowing in concern.
"Ahrim, you shouldn't be here," Liana whispered, her voice trembling.
Ahrim stepped forward, his presence filling the air with an aura of power. "Liana, I can't leave you alone in this. We need to talk."
"We need to leave this place," she said, her voice steady despite the fear that gnawed at her insides. "If we're caught, there will be no turning back."
Ahrim's eyes softened. "Liana, I have a plan. I will take you to the hidden lair of the elder dragons, where we can be safe. They will understand our plight."
Liana's heart raced. "The elder dragons? But what if they turn us away? They are the ones who have forbidden our love."
Ahrim took her hand in his, his grip firm and reassuring. "They are wise, and they know the value of love. We must trust in them."
The two of them made their way through the forest, the bond between them growing stronger with each step. But as they drew closer to the lair, the path became fraught with danger. Lurking in the shadows were the sentinels of the elder dragons, their eyes trained on the intruders.
One of the sentinels stepped forward, his voice a deep rumble. "Who dares enter the lair of the elder dragons?"
Ahrim stepped forward, his presence commanding. "We come in peace, guardian. We seek guidance and understanding."
The sentinel's eyes narrowed. "The elder dragons have long forbidden such unions. Why do you seek their favor?"
Liana stepped forward, her voice filled with determination. "Because love knows no bounds, and we seek a place where our love can be accepted."
The sentinel's expression softened. "Very well, you may enter. But know this: if the elder dragons decide against you, there will be no appeal."
Ahrim nodded. "We accept your terms."
Inside the lair, the elder dragons sat in their thrones, their ancient eyes boring into the pair. Ahrim and Liana stood before them, their hearts pounding in their chests.
"We come before you, seeking your wisdom and guidance," Ahrim began. "We love each other, and we cannot bear to be apart."
The elder dragons exchanged a look of deep contemplation. Finally, the eldest dragon, a being of immense power and wisdom, spoke.
"You have shown courage and determination, and we recognize the depth of your love. But you must understand that the balance of power must be maintained. You must choose between your love and your duty."
Liana stepped forward, her voice filled with resolve. "I choose love. I am willing to face any consequence, as long as Ahrim is by my side."
The elder dragons exchanged a look of mutual understanding. "Then it is decided. Your love is accepted, but with it comes a price. You must prove your worth through trials of strength, wisdom, and courage."
Ahrim and Liana bowed their heads in acceptance. They had chosen their path, and now they must face the challenges that awaited them. The future of their love and the fate of their worlds hung in the balance.
In the heart of the dragon, Liana and Ahrim's love would be tested, and in the end, their destiny would be shaped by the choices they made. The heart of the dragon beat strong, and the tale of their forbidden love would be whispered through the ages.
